The effect of copper (II) and chloride ions on the manganese (II) catalyzed iodate‐peroxide reaction has been examined with reference to the hydrogen peroxide‐iodic acid‐manganese (II)‐organic species oscillatory reaction. The observations are considered to provide evidence for iodine dioxide as the key intermediate in the manganese (II) catalyzed reaction. Kinetic data for the copper (II) catalyzed reaction are reported.
